A group of young people taking part in the Tigers Trust NCS project have raised over £200 for the charity When You Wish Upon a Star.

Held at The Beaver Pub in Beverley, the group held a night of music raising money through donations and selling tickets for a prize draw.

Speaking about the event, Team Leader Assistant, Megan Tattersall said;  

“We think the event went amazingly well being organised by a group of 15 to 16 year olds.”

“Everything ran very smoothly with no hiccups. I am so proud that they were able to organise everything from a venue, bands, a singer, prizes and more.”

“In all we raised £235 without small change – which is a fantastic total.”

Megan explained why the charity, When You Wish Upon a Star, which aims to grant the wishes of children living with a life threatening illness, she said;

“We chose When You Wish Upon a Star because one of the girls in my team sadly had Ovarian cancer at the age of 8 years old.”

“This charity is very special for her as it helped her, her family and friends get through an impossible time.”

“We wanted to give back to this charity for helping one of our girls, and not only raise money but also awareness of what they do.”

“Everyone connected with the event would like to say a special thank you to a number of local businesses who supported the night.”

“There were some lovely prices which were donated from shops including Browns of Beverley, Boots and The Beaver themselves were just fantastic.”
